4wd issues

Hey guys, i need some serious wiring genius here.
So we've identified the tranny and tcase in my jeep kit car....from an Ln130 surf/hilux/pickup 1988-1993 with the electric/push button shift (actuator on the back of T-case)
My question is, how do i wire up the system to engage 4wd, bearing in mind i have no A.D.D or ECU, i have no light or switch/button in the cab either (ford 3l v6 essex and nissan chassis with r180 lsd diff and man hubs)
I'm sure i can find any old switch for the purpose, and there is a 4wd indication light on my speedo so i can prolly use that, but odds are it doesn't work so i'd set up another one close to wherever i put the switch, my question is HOW do i do all of this without permanently damaging the actuator or t-case
Could anyone help me out with this? the way i see it it's just putting a switch that sends power to the actuator, which is told when to stop by the sensor on the actuator probably via some sort of relay which then sends signal to a light to tell me i'm engaged? perhaps i'm over simplifying it and in all honesty i wouldn't know where to start. There are 5 wires in total coming out the actuator (2 from the base which i think may be power for motor and 3 out the back cover which i assume are the limit signals) There is also a sensor/transmitter bolted into where the actuator shaft enters the tcase, which i assume is the 4wd indication....is this correct?
